Share Electron's offscreen window's frame to Spout output.
It listens to paint event and copies the frame data, sends to native module, copies to D3D11Texture2D and share.
- Visual Studio (tested on 2022) with C++ core desktop enviroment
- cmake
- vcpkg Install and use packages with CMake
setting VCPKG_ROOT env variable is important

Build and use the .node file in your project
let win = new BrowserWindow({
title: "MyWindow",
webPreferences: {
preload,
offscreen: true,
offscreenUseSharedTexture: true,
},
show: false,
transparent: true,
});
const { SpoutOutput } = require("electron_spout.node");
const osr = new SpoutOutput("Electron Output");
win.webContents.setFrameRate(60);
win.webContents.on("paint", (event, dirty, image, texture) => {
if (texture) {
// when offscreenUseSharedTexture = true
osr.updateTexture(texture);
} else {
osr.updateFrame(image.getBitmap(), image.getSize());
}
});
